Azent WordPress Theme: A Practical Look for Agencies

Azent is a WordPress theme designed for creative agencies, web design studios, and similar businesses. It leverages the Elementor page builder, which means most of the visual design and layout work is done through a drag-and-drop interface. This theme aims to get you a professional-looking website up and running quickly, especially if you're building sites for clients who need a polished online presence without a massive custom build.

For agencies or freelancers who need to launch client sites fast, Azent can be a real time-saver. The included demos and pre-made blocks mean you're not starting from scratch with every project. If you're frequently building websites for creative businesses, the pre-built elements for showcasing portfolios or services are directly relevant. This theme is particularly useful for those who rely heavily on Elementor for their workflow and want a solid foundation to build upon.

Who Should Consider Azent and Who Should Look Elsewhere

This theme is best suited for web designers and developers who are comfortable using Elementor and need to deliver projects efficiently. If you often build sites for creative agencies, design studios, or similar businesses, the included demos and components will likely align with your clients' needs. It's a good option if you're looking for a theme that provides a lot of pre-built options to accelerate development and reduce the need for extensive custom styling for common agency layouts.

However, if you're a developer who needs deep backend customization or a highly specific, niche functionality that isn't covered by standard agency needs, Azent might not be the best fit. It's not designed for complex custom application development within WordPress. Also, if you prefer to build everything from the ground up with minimal theme influence or are not an Elementor user, you'll find more value in a different type of solution.

Accelerating Agency Website Development

The core problem Azent solves is the time spent on repetitive design and layout tasks for agency websites. Instead of manually creating every section, you can import a demo and then customize it. The "one-click demo import" feature is standard for themes like this, but its effectiveness here means you can get a fully structured starting point in minutes. This saves hours on initial setup and styling, allowing you to focus on content and client-specific tweaks. It’s particularly helpful when trying to meet tight project deadlines for clients needing a professional online presence.

The theme also includes a variety of pre-made blocks and over 40 custom Elementor addons. This means you have a good selection of ready-to-use components for things like service listings, team member profiles, testimonials, and contact forms, which are common requirements for agency sites. This approach speeds up the process of building out inner pages and specific content sections, contributing to faster project completion times and helping you build conversion-ready funnels more effectively.

Layouts and Pre-built Content

Azent provides four distinct homepage demos, each offering a different visual approach to presenting an agency. Alongside these, you get 14 inner pages and over 50 ready blocks. This collection gives you a solid starting point for most common pages like About Us, Services, Contact, and Portfolio. The inclusion of four header and four footer styles offers decent flexibility for branding and navigation without needing to build them from scratch. For those looking to create an ecommerce website template, note that while it mentions WooCommerce compatibility, it's not a primary focus of the included demos.

Elementor Integration and Customization

The theme is built around Elementor, which is a popular choice for many developers. This means you'll find a familiar workflow if you're already using this page builder. The 40+ custom Elementor addons provide extra widgets beyond Elementor's default set, offering more options for design and content presentation. This integration is straightforward, and the "mobile-first design" mentioned suggests that layouts should adapt well to different screen sizes, which is crucial for user experience and SEO.

Code Quality and Developer Experience

From what we can see, Azent seems to follow standard practices for WordPress theme development using Elementor. The code is described as "elaborated clean code," which is what you'd expect from a reputable theme. This means it should be relatively easy to work with if you need to make minor CSS adjustments or understand the structure. The theme is translation-ready, which is a standard feature that helps in creating multilingual websites, benefiting international clients or broader audience reach. The use of Redux Framework for theme options is also a common and stable choice, providing a centralized place for global settings.

FAQ

What is the primary benefit of using Azent for a digital agency website?

The primary benefit is the significant reduction in development time due to pre-built demos, layouts, and custom Elementor addons, allowing for faster client site launches.

Is Azent suitable for building an online store?

While it mentions WooCommerce compatibility, Azent is primarily focused on agency and portfolio sites; it's not optimized for complex or high-volume ecommerce businesses.

How easy is it to customize Azent if I'm not a developer?

If you are comfortable with Elementor, customization is straightforward. The theme options panel and detailed documentation also aid in making adjustments.

What kind of support can I expect with Azent?

The theme comes with detailed documentation and video guides, which are standard for WordPress themes on marketplaces like ThemeForest.
